## Deploy Step 4 — Tune GC for PairDesk Matcher

Before starting the matcher, set garbage-collection parameters in `matcher.env`. New team members should begin with `PD_GC_PAUSE_TARGET_MS=40` and `PD_HEAP_CEILING_MB=4096`; pauses above 100 ms cause visible matching lag during peak load. After tuning, verify with `pdctl gc-report` on a canary node before rolling out. The matcher also reports pause metrics to the central collector and must authenticate, so its reporting credential is defined on the line that follows.

vault entry, kahag-fawif: VAULT_KEY13=5b0be3c5cb90d

// We therefore deduplicate on sequence number and resynchronize against
// the nightly full count published by the Verlan facilities system.
// If drift between computed and reported occupancy exceeds the tolerance,
// we freeze the public display value rather than show a negative count.
// Please review the tolerance and resync cadence carefully before the
// Pinefield rollout; they are defined in the constants below.

limits module of fajog-tawig:
RATE_LIMITS = {
    "druwyn": 2,
    "quenael": 10,
    "wenix": 2,
    "druael": 2,
}

## Step 4: Migrate FeedSentry's validation settings

Before cutting over, confirm that the legacy PodCheck rules have been exported from the Varnholt cluster. FeedSentry parses enclosure tags more strictly than PodCheck did, so any feed relying on lenient MIME detection will now fail validation. Future maintainers should note that the strictness flags cannot be changed at runtime; a restart is required. Once the export is verified, apply the values below to the staging instance exactly as written.

service settings:
[casax]
port = 6379
team = rusir
host = casax.zemvarhq.corp
region = outer-4
access_code = ac_9808ce
timeout_ms = 1500

## Tuning the Rate Limiter

Welcome aboard! The Gatekeeper gateway throttles every internal caller using a token-bucket per service identity. Most of the time you won't touch these knobs — the defaults were picked after the Great Batch Job Stampede of last spring, and they've held up well. If a team genuinely needs more headroom, bump their bucket in config rather than editing code. Burst size matters more than refill rate for spiky clients, so adjust that first. Here are the current defaults.

tuning table, yajog-yahof:
BUDGETS = {
    "lamvan": 303,
    "wenox": 460,
    "fenvan": 525,
}